The IVR Development Manager is responsible for designing, developing, and supporting IVR systems that facilitate efficient communication between our customers and our business. Responsibilities include enhancing, delivering and maintaining Interactive Voice Response (IVR) platforms that align with business goals while proactively mitigating risk. This role will manage and oversee outsourced IVR developers to validate design, solution, effort, feasibility, functionality and best practice is followed.
What You Will Do
- Design, Testing, Integration:
- Design and develop IVR applications integrating other technologies such as Google Dialogflow, Alvaria, Chatbot, NICE Technology, EDW/Reporting and UCCE suite of applications.
- Integrate solutions with backend systems and databases, languages and platforms such as Java, VXML, Call Studio and SQL.
- Perform unit, functional, and integration testing of IVR applications. Collaborate with QA and Digital Team during product lifecycle development.
- Integrate speech recognition and text-to-speech/text to speech technologies.
- Maintain and update existing IVR systems to ensure high availability and performance.
- Document technical designs, system workflows, and process improvements.
- Project Management:
- Lead the planning, execution, and completion of IVR projects and operations, ensuring stability and availability, and delivery of solutions on time and within budget.
- Provide technical IVR leadership and guidance to project teams, maintain documentation, ensure that technical solutions meet business requirements.
- Technical Solutions:
- Collaborate with architects and other technical experts to design robust IVR solutions, while mitigating risk, ensuring deliverables meet quality standards.
- Understand business requirements and expectations to develop technical solutions.
- Resolve issues related to IVR applications and infrastructure including integration components and IVR call flow/code.
- Work closely with cross-functional teams, including business analysts, QA engineers, and project managers to meet business requirements.
- Resource Management:
- Manage resource allocation of technical resources, vendors, and ensure effective use of skills and expertise within the team.
- Validate design, solution, effort, feasibility, functionality and best practice is followed
- Minimum 5-7 years progressive experience managing IVR systems including the design, analyzes and optimizing Call Center call flows. and developing end to end IVR solutions particularly Cisco UCCE platforms version 12.x and above.
- Experience working with tools (i.e., Call Studio/CVP Studio, MS Office, MS Visio, MS Project) required.
- NLU experience preferably with Google Dialog Flow NLP
- experience using CVP studio/Call Studio
- Experience with Finesse, CUIC, CCMP, PG, CVP, VXML, Java, J2EE, SOAP, REST APIs, SQL
- Document/Update call flow and IVR business process
- Experience working with ServiceNow is preferred
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ology or a related field.
- Cisco UCCE certification, Agile training, Cisco CVP Development Training a plus.
- Strong experience with IVR development platforms, (e.g. Cisco)
- Strong communication & interpersonal skills.
-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
- Ability to lead a team of outsourced IVR developers.
- Demonstrated strong troubleshooting skills with Cisco UCCE platform to troubleshoot and optimize system performance
- Ability to integrate technologies such as NLU into Cisco UCCE/IVR platform.
- Proficient in Cisco UCCE suite of applications.
- Understanding of Alvaria Dialer, Nice Call Recording and Google DialogFlow.
- Proven experience collaborating with cross functional teams and business stakeholders.
